Businesses across state get bomb threats; State Police say no bombs actually found yet

State Police report a wave of threats today, possibly related to similar threats across the country:

MSP and partner agencies on federal and local levels are conducting risk assessment procedures regarding the threats and will determine appropriate responses. NO indications of any explosives located or detonated to this point.
